Intel identifies chipset design error, implementing solution
In some cases, the Serial-ATA (SATA) ports within the chipsets may degrade over time, potentially impacting the performance or functionality of SATA-linked devices such as hard disk drives and DVD-drives.
The chipset is utilised in PCs with Intel’s latest Second Generation Intel Core processors, code-named Sandy Bridge. Intel has stopped shipment of the affected support chip from its factories, corrected the design issue, and has begun manufacturing a new version of the support chip which will resolve the issue.
The Sandy Bridge microprocessor is unaffected and no other products are affected by this issue.
The company expects to begin delivering the updated version of the chipset to customers in late February and expects full volume recovery in April.
For computer makers and other Intel customers that have bought potentially affected chipsets or systems, Intel will work with its OEM partners to accept the return of the affected chipsets, and plans to support modifications or replacements needed on motherboards or systems.
The only systems sold to an end customer potentially impacted are Second Generation Core i5 and Core i7 quad core based systems. Intel believes that consumers can continue to use their systems with confidence, while working with their computer manufacturer for a permanent solution.
